Description
CRANBORNE SU 01 SE BOVERIDGE
7/10 Cottage 130m south-wests of King's Post
II
Cottage, late C17 or early C18. Brick and rendered cob with thatched roof, half-hipped to the right. Brick end stack left. One and a half storeys single window range. 2-light casements with horizontal glazing bars, that to the ground floor right is contained within an earlier heavy timber-surround. Central original plank door in heavy timber-frame.
Internal features (RCHM): stop-chamfered ceiling beam and chamfered timber fireplace bressummer with run-out stops. (RCHM, Dorset, vol. V, p.14, no.25.)
